Hoofd Google Spreadsheets Hoe gegevens in Google Spreadsheets te normaliseren?

Hoe gegevens in Google Spreadsheets te normaliseren?



Als u met grotere datasets in Google Spreadsheets werkt, kan het vergelijken van variabelewaarden een vervelend proces zijn. Gelukkig is normalisatie een statistische methode waarmee u gecompliceerde waarden kunt sorteren in gemakkelijk te vergelijken gegevenssets.

In dit artikel wordt uitgelegd wat normalisatie is en hoe u gegevens in Google Spreadsheets kunt normaliseren voor statistische voordelen.

Hoe gegevens in Google Spreadsheets te normaliseren?

Stel dat we enkele numerieke waarden hebben in cellen van A2 tot A50. Om dat bereik te normaliseren in waarden tussen X en Y, moet u het volgende doen:

  1. Als uw eerste gegevenspunt zich in A2 bevindt, kan de eerste genormaliseerde waarde worden gevonden met behulp van deze formule:

    (YX) * ((A2-MIN ($ A $ 2: $ A $ 50)) / (MAX ($ A $ 2: $ A $ 50) -MIN ($ A $ 2: $ A $ 50))) + Y

    Gebruik de numerieke waarden voor X en Y rechtstreeks.

  2. Nadat u de formule voor het eerste getal heeft ingevoerd, verplaatst u de muiscursor naar de onderkant van de cel totdat deze een kruis wordt. Druk vervolgens op en sleep de cursor naar beneden om de resterende rijen met de formule te vullen. Google Spreadsheets vervangt A2 automatisch door het overeenkomstige rijnummer voor de resterende cellen, terwijl alles achter $ symbolen niet verandert.

  3. Als u naar de waarden van X en Y uit andere cellen in de bladen wilt verwijzen, moet u $ s plaatsen voor de rij en kolom van de cellen waarin de waarden staan ​​(bijvoorbeeld $ D $ 5), of u moet de formule kopiëren kan u een parseerfout of verkeerde resultaten opleveren.

  4. Uw gegevens worden nu genormaliseerd tussen X- en Y-waarden.

Het normaliseren van uw gegevens is een uitstekende manier om de verschillen tussen twee gegevenssets met verschillende minimum- en maximumwaarden te meten.

Google Spreadsheets als database gebruiken

Elke database is in wezen een grote tabel (of veel onderling verbonden tabellen), bestuurd door een databasebeheersysteem. Als u met een relatief kleine dataset werkt die niet al te veel hoeft te schalen, kan Google Spreadsheets als uw database worden gebruikt.

hoe kan ik me afmelden bij disney plus

Als u Google Spreadsheets als uw database wilt gaan gebruiken, heeft u een achtergrond in basisprogrammering nodig. Je hebt ook een API nodig om het blad compatibel te maken met SQL en Python. Hoewel Google een uitgebreide API biedt voor zijn services, is het misschien iets te veel om mee om te gaan. Daarom raden we aan sheet2api of Autocode om de API-behoefte op te lossen. De API-services bieden de verbinding en authenticaties die nodig zijn om uw Google Spreadsheets als uw database te verbinden en bieden voldoende eindpunten om een ​​goede databaseworkflow mogelijk te maken.

Het belangrijkste voordeel van het gebruik van Google Spreadsheets als database is dat u altijd een visueel overzicht van alle gegevens heeft. Aangezien Google Spreadsheets beschikbaar is als app voor mobiele apparaten en compatibel is met de meeste browsers en besturingssystemen, is uw database overal ter wereld toegankelijk. U kunt gegevens in het blad zelf ook direct bekijken en bewerken, in plaats van code te gebruiken om een ​​query door de database uit te voeren om wijzigingen aan te brengen.

Google Spreadsheets heeft echter zijn beperkingen op het gebied van databasebeheer. Ten eerste is er een duidelijk gebrek aan relationele functies. Databases zijn meestal samengesteld uit veel tabellen die gebruik maken van externe sleutels om met elkaar te communiceren, een proces dat simpelweg niet bestaat in één enkele spreadsheet.

Als u een voorbeeld wilt bekijken, kijk dan eens naar de afdelingen in uw bedrijf. In een spreadsheet zijn dit meestal gewoon getypte tekenreeksen. Dat is echter onverstandig voor een grotere dataset. In databases zou u een aparte tabel hebben voor bedrijfsafdelingen, waarbij elke afdeling overeenkomstig wordt genummerd. Vervolgens verwijst u met een externe sleutel naar het nummer van de afdeling in de gegevens over een werknemer. Met een aparte afdelingstabel kunt u direct wijzigingen aanbrengen in de afdelingen zelf zonder de wijzigingen door de hele database te laten lopen.

Bovendien kunnen in Google Spreadsheets slechts vijf miljoen cellen tegelijk worden opgeslagen. Hoewel dit een groot aantal lijkt, kunnen zelfs middelgrote bedrijven databases hebben die deze limiet ver overschrijden. Bovendien bereikt u prestatieproblemen veel sneller voordat u de cellimiet bereikt. Met een schijnbaar lineaire schaal tussen het aantal cellen en de prestaties, zult u aanzienlijke vertragingen oplopen bij het werken met een database met 100 duizend cellen.

Aanvullende veelgestelde vragen

Kunt u gegevens invoegen in Google Spreadsheets?

Met de ingebouwde API van Google kunt u een tabel rechtstreeks vanuit bestanden invoegen. De tool voor het importeren van bestanden ondersteunt de volgende extensies:

• .xls

• .xlsx

• .xlsm

• .xlt

• .xltx

• .xltm

• .ods

• .csv

• .tekst

• .tsv

• .tab

Bovendien heeft software van derden meestal integraties met Google Spreadsheets. Sheets2api en Autocode, die we eerder hebben besproken, hebben beide API-oplossingen om gegevens in bestaande tabellen in te voegen.

U kunt ook de functie IMPORTRANGE gebruiken om gegevens van het ene Google-blad naar het andere in te voegen.

Google heeft ook scriptinstructies om inhoud in een spreadsheet te schrijven.

Als u erin slaagt een API-oplossing te vinden die voor u werkt, kunt u eenvoudig gegevens in Google Spreadsheets invoegen nadat u deze heeft verbonden met uw platform.

zal de Nintendo Switch Wii U-games spelen?

Hoe kan ik gegevens in Google Spreadsheets opschonen?

Google Spreadsheets biedt verschillende oplossingen voor het opschonen en sorteren van gegevens.

Als u Google Formulieren gebruikt om enquêteresultaten te verzamelen, kunt u Formulieren zo instellen dat reacties automatisch in een spreadsheet worden geplakt, in plaats van de gegevens handmatig te plakken.

Google Spreadsheets heeft ook een functie voor gegevensvalidatie. Als u naar Gegevens> Gegevensvalidatie gaat, kunt u validatiefuncties instellen om onjuiste waarden te voorkomen. U kunt bijvoorbeeld een lijst maken met items die in een bepaalde kolom kunnen worden geplaatst, en als u iets anders probeert in te voegen, zal dit een fout opleveren.

Google Spreadsheets heeft ook de opties Duplicaten verwijderen en Witruimte inkorten. Hiermee worden eventuele extra waarden en spaties uit uw rijen en cellen verwijderd.

hoe u al uw opmerkingen op youtube kunt bekijken

Als je meer georganiseerde gegevens van online pagina's wilt plakken, gebruik dan IMPORTHTML of IMPORTXML om de informatie die je nodig hebt van een webpagina te halen, zonder de extra rommel.

Wat betekent het om gegevens te normaliseren?

In statistieken stelt het normaliseren van gegevens u in staat om verschillende datasets beter vergelijkbaar te maken.

Wanneer u gegevens normaliseert, kunt u het oorspronkelijke numerieke waardebereik wijzigen in een bereik van uw keuze. U kunt bijvoorbeeld verschillende scoremethoden normaliseren in hetzelfde waardebereik om ze met elkaar te vergelijken.

Het normaliseren van een waarde x die afkomstig is van een bereik (y, z) naar een bereik (a, b), wordt gedaan met de volgende formule:

X_ genormaliseerd = (b - a) * ((x - y) / (z - y)) + a

Het normaliseren van gegevens is handig als uw oorspronkelijke datasets geen zuivere waarden hebben. Het standaardiseren van de bereiken naar (0,100) kan bijvoorbeeld helpen om een ​​snel overzicht van scores te krijgen, onafhankelijk van de maximale waarde van de scores zelf.

Een aanvullende statistische methode bij gegevensevaluatie is standaardisatie. Hierdoor hebben de oorspronkelijke numerieke waarden een gemiddelde van 0 en een standaarddeviatie van 1. De gestandaardiseerde waarden worden vaak z-scores genoemd.

Google Sheets heeft een functie waarmee u een dataset kunt standaardiseren. De functie STANDARDIZE (x, mean, standard_dev) zal de numerieke waarde, x, in zijn gestandaardiseerde vorm plaatsen. U kunt de functie GEMIDDELD (bereik) gebruiken om de gemiddelde waarde van uw gegevens in de tabel te krijgen en de functie ST_DEV (bereik) gebruiken om de standaarddeviatie van de gegevensset te berekenen.

Het interpreteren van gestandaardiseerde gegevens is een beetje anders. Een gestandaardiseerd getal van -1,5 betekent bijvoorbeeld dat de oorspronkelijke waarde 1,5 keer de standaarddeviatie van de set kleiner is dan het gemiddelde.

Standaardisatie kan handig zijn om de waarden van verschillende datasets met verschillende verwachtingen en middelen te vergelijken. Aangezien een standaardisatie het gemiddelde altijd op 0 zet en een afwijking op 1, zullen de werkelijke waarden die in de dataset worden gepresenteerd de vergelijking niet verstoren.

Statistische analyse kan een dataset ook transformeren zodat deze geschikt is voor een bepaalde distributie, maar dat is een geavanceerde statistische functie die in deze handleiding niet wordt behandeld.

Nieuw normaal

Het normaliseren van datasets is een ongelooflijk handig hulpmiddel bij data-analyse, en Google Sheets biedt een snelle oplossing om numerieke data te normaliseren. Bovendien kunt u Google Spreadsheets gebruiken als een kleine database, als u niet met buitengewone hoeveelheden datasets voor uw werk werkt. De integraties die Google Sheets heeft met software van derden, maken het geschikt voor een breed scala aan industrieën. De juiste databases zullen echter veel schaalbaarder zijn.

Welk type informatie normaliseert u gewoonlijk in Google Spreadsheets? Gebruikt u Google Spreadsheets voor uw database? Laat het ons weten in de comments hieronder.

Interessante Artikelen

Editor'S Choice

Hoe u uw Instagram aan Tik Tok . kunt toevoegen
Hoe u uw Instagram aan Tik Tok . kunt toevoegen
Hoewel het een pionier was in het concept, heeft Instagram beperkte opties als het gaat om het maken van korte videoverhalen, dus veel gebruikers wenden zich tot andere apps als ze iets unieks willen maken. TikTok is een app die alleen voor dat doel is ontworpen.
Raspberry Pi Zero W review: de £ 10 Raspberry Pi die je je niet kunt veroorloven om niet te kopen
Raspberry Pi Zero W review: de £ 10 Raspberry Pi die je je niet kunt veroorloven om niet te kopen
Je moet het aan de Raspberry Pi Foundation overhandigen. Niet tevreden met het weer goedkoop en cool maken van computergebruik door hobbyisten, deed de Stichting vorig jaar iets onverwachts: het bracht een nog goedkoper model uit. Geprijsd voor een belachelijk lage £
Hoe ESPN Plus te annuleren
Hoe ESPN Plus te annuleren
Voor een fervent sportliefhebber kunnen er momenten zijn waarop een ESPN Plus-abonnement niet echt nuttig is. Ontdek hoe u ESPN Plus kunt opzeggen, zodat u er niet voor hoeft te betalen als u het niet gebruikt.
Hoe schakel ik TTS in Discord in?
Hoe schakel ik TTS in Discord in?
Tekst naar spraak, afgekort als TTS, is een vorm van spraaksynthese die tekst omzet in gesproken spraakuitvoer. TTS-systemen zijn theoretisch in staat om:
Nieuwe thema's toevoegen aan Google Chrome
Nieuwe thema's toevoegen aan Google Chrome
U kunt in de meeste browsers nieuwe thema's toevoegen die achtergrondafbeeldingen en kleurenschema's aanpassen. Google Chrome is een browser met een overvloed aan thema's die beschikbaar zijn op websites. Als alternatief kunt u ook uw eigen aangepaste thema's toevoegen aan Chrome met
Windows 10 versie 1607 heeft het einde van de ondersteuning bereikt
Windows 10 versie 1607 heeft het einde van de ondersteuning bereikt
Windows 10 versie 1607 is uitgebracht in augustus 2016. Sindsdien heeft Microsoft een aantal belangrijke updates uitgebracht voor het Windows 10-platform, waaronder Creators Update (versie 1703) en Fall Creators Update (versie 1709). Tegelijkertijd hebben eerdere Windows 10-versies een heleboel cumulatieve updates ontvangen, waaronder beveiligingsoplossingen en stabiliteitsverbeteringen. Langs
Voeg aangepaste blokkeringslijsten toe voor advertentieblokkering in Opera
Voeg aangepaste blokkeringslijsten toe voor advertentieblokkering in Opera
Beginnend met Opera 38, werd de mogelijkheid om aangepaste lijsten toe te voegen in de ingebouwde functie voor het blokkeren van advertenties aan de browser toegevoegd. Hier ziet u hoe u aangepaste blokkeringslijsten kunt toevoegen.